ZURICH — FIFA has suspended Thai soccer association president Worawi Makudi for 90 days.

The FIFA ethics committee says a breach of its code appears to have been committed and the case “is now the subject of formal investigation proceedings”.

Details of the allegations were not provided in today’s (Oct 12) statement but Worawi has been under investigation for his conduct during the 2018 and 2022 World Cup bidding contests.

Worawi was a FIFA executive committee member for 18 years until May.

In July, Worawi was found guilty of forgery in his 2013 re-election to lead the Thai federation. A Bangkok criminal court sentenced Worawi to a suspended jail term of one year and four months. AP
